The temperature ranged from 19.4°C around 05:00 to 24.9°C around 16:00. Rain was recorded across 6 hours, from around 09:00 to 22:00 (1.2mm total).

Data type
Reanalysis — a physically consistent reconstruction combining a forecast model with historical observations, not a live station reading or a forecast

Limitations
A model reconstruction, not a station observation — hyper-local extremes (a single storm cell, an urban heat pocket) can differ from a nearby gauge. See the full methodology.
